Postcode 3241 and postcode 3251 are nearby Victorian areas with very different levels of accessibility and demographics. Postcode 3241 is more walkable, with 52.4% of homes within a 15-minute walk of groceries, compared to 0% in postcode 3251. It is also a younger area, where the typical resident is 43, while the typical person in postcode 3251 is 50. Postcode 3241 has a higher share of people who finished Year 12 (45.7% versus 34.1%) and more recent arrivals, with 38.9% moving in during the last five years compared to 27.9% in postcode 3251.

Both areas have typical personal incomes that sit near the national figure, with postcode 3241 at $744 and postcode 3251 at $716 per week. They also share similar levels of home size, with about 81% of dwellings having three or more bedrooms. Over time, some gaps have widened; the difference in the typical age of residents has grown to seven years, and the share of people who have finished Year 12 is now 11.6 percentage points higher in postcode 3241.
